Root Canal Therapy is recommended for individuals with infected or damaged tooth pulp, causing severe pain or discomfort.
The healthcare provider administers a local anesthetic to numb the area, ensuring you won’t feel any pain during the treatment. Therefore, the procedure is painless.
A Root Canal Therapy session typically lasts one to two hours, depending on the tooth’s complexity.
Whenever possible, saving a natural tooth through Root Canal Therapy is preferred to extraction, as it preserves your dental structure.
After the procedure, you might feel some mild discomfort, but you can manage it by taking over-the-counter pain relievers. Make sure to follow the post-procedure instructions given by your dentist to achieve the best results.
With proper maintenance, a tooth treated with root canal therapy can last a lifetime, but regular dental check-ups are essential for monitoring its condition.
